Prepaid plans may be administered by ...MOST &mdash Missouri's 529 Education Plan is affordable, tax-advantaged, easy to join, and open to everyone.The Bright Start 529 College Savings Plan, highly rated by Morningstar since 2017, offers flexible investment options, low costs, and quality fund families. * Plus, for Illinois taxpayers, a state income tax deduction for contributions of up to $10,000 per individual ($20,000 for married couples). 1.Florida offers a prepaid tuition plan and a 529 savings plan, both which have Florida residency requirements. The Stanley G. Tate Florida Prepaid College Plan is the largest prepaid plan in the nation. It is unique among contract-type prepaid programs in offering a dormitory option in addition to its various tuition and fees packages. Contributions. Wisconsin offers a state tax deduction for contributions to a 529 plan in 2023 of up to $3,860 per beneficiary ($1,930 for married filing separate status and divorced parents of a beneficiary). Minimum: $25. Maximum: Accepts contributions until all account balances for the same beneficiary reach $527,000.Your 529 savings plan withdrawals will be free from federal tax as long as you use them for qualified education expenses like room and board, tuition, required books and supplies for higher education. You can also use your 529 plan to pay for K-12 tuition up to $10,000 per year per beneficiary.
